Job summary
A healthcare facility in Spokane, WA, seeks a Physical Therapist for the NICU to provide crucial patient care and support for premature and medically complex infants. This part-time role, with opportunities for full-time hours, involves working within a healthcare team to ensure the best developmental outcomes. Required qualifications include a Washington state physical therapist license and BLS certification. Join our dedicated team committed to patient-centered care and professional growth.
